How do you rate Felix Trinidad?
There was a time when people were saying he would have blasted Hearns, Leonard, Duran, etc. Obviously, that time has passed.
DeLaHoya seemed to be outboxing him and winning until he just stopped fighting and gave it away. Hopkin's boxing skills mixed with power totally dismantled him. And now, Winky's boxing skills took him to school and shut him out. Tommy Hearns was a good enough boxer to outbox Wilfred Benitez before Benitez was shot. Mix that with Hearn's power and it's hard to see Trinidad winning. Ray Leonard had great boxing skills and decent power. It's hard to see Trinidad beating him, either. Is Trinidad overrated? Against fighters with average boxing ability he was a destroyer. Ditto for his abilities against sluggers. My guess is, against the higher skilled boxers, he was vulnerable. Anyone who allowed him to set his feet and fire was in trouble. Counter punchers with movement would give him problems. Especially those with good chins and some power. |

*cough* overated....try to think of who he has really beaten?
Whitaker- was old De La Hoya- cmon he was totally outclassed for 8 rounds by Oscar Vargas-great fight, Tito almost got himself knocked out, wheres Vargas now? Camacho- meh.. was also on downside of career David Reid- was already shot Joppy- enuff said Mayorga- clearly a 1 dimensional fighter tailor made for Tito Hopkins- blown out Wright- clinically dissected for 12 rounds..didn't land a single clean shot, in other words...blown out sad...but true ![]()
